Converting formulas to values using Excel shortcuts Select all the cells with formulas that you want to convert. Press Ctrl + C or Ctrl + Ins to copy formulas and their results to clipboard. Press Shift + F10 and then V to paste only values back to Excel cells.
Copy cell as text value not formula with Excel build-in function Select the range you want to copy as text value only, and press Ctrl + C. Click to select a blank cell for placing the copied cells. Then click Home Paste Values. See screenshot:
Combine Cells With Text and a Number Select the cell in which you want the combined data. Type the formula, with text inside double quotes. For example: =Due in A3 days NOTE: To separate the text strings from the numbers, end or begin the text string with a space. Press Enter to complete the formula.
Delete a formula but keep the results Select the cell or range of cells that contains the formula. Click Home Copy (or press Ctrl + C). Click Home arrow below Paste Paste Values.
Click Format Cells. Click the Number tab. Select Text from the Category list. Click OK.
To add both the text and formula in the same cell, you have to use the symbol, and double inverted comma(). So, if you want to add texts in between cell values or formulas or functions, just separate them using and double inverted commas. For example in the above formula, first, we have inserted cell B5.
To add a certain character or text to a formula result, just concatenate a string with the formula itself. To explain to your users what time that is, you can place some text before and/or after the formula.
We often hear that you want to make data easier to understand by including text in your formulas, such as 2,347 units sold. To include text in your functions and formulas, surround the text with double quotes ().
Usually you type =A1 for referring to the cell A1 in Excel. But instead, there is also another method: You could use the INDIRECT formula. The formula returns the reference given in a text. So instead of directly linking to =A1, you could say =INDIRECT(A1).
